    Default Quilting with Minkee

    Hi All!
    I'm wondering if anyone has tried using a lite iron-on stabilizer with Minkee as the backing when free motion quilting? I have a problem with it being so "stretchy." Suggestions/comments appreciated!

    Cat I think it depends on the quilter. I have had one baby quilt done with minkee and I am almost sure she used a light weight stabilizer with it. I am working on another quilt and asked a different long arm quilter if I needed to get her a stabilizer and she said she doesn't use one with it. Hopefully a few long arm quilters will give you some advice from hands on experience.

    I'm not a long arm quilter, I quilt with my Juki or Babylock on a table. I spray baste when I use minkee and have never had a problem. The quilts are so cuddly with the minkee.

    I have made an entire quilt out of minky on my longarm and used it for backing several times. It really is a lot easier to longarm it than use the dsm in my opinion as you aren't pushing and pulling it so there are less chances to stretch it...
